Loretta Lawson, English professor and sometime sleuth, is looking forward to a quiet Christmas, putting the finishing touches on her Edith Wharton biography and spending quality time with her new beau, Robert. And then Sandra calls. A member of Loretta's disbanded women's group, she's in desperate need of a place to stay over the holidays, and what can Loretta do but let her sleep on the foldout couch for a few days. Unfortunately, a few days turns into a bit more, and Loretta begins to feel persecuted in her own flat. Still, when Sandra vanishes without a word right around New Year's, Loretta grows worried. Making a few calls, tracking down their old group, Loretta finds herself crawling about Sandra's strange private life, uncovering sordid truths that might have something to do with her mysterious and troubling disappearance. . . . "Establishes Smith as the star of the younger generation." -- *London Evening Standard*
